One common theme is identity. Given Taiwan's complex history of different colonial powers and its own indigenous cultures, novels often explore how the characters define themselves. For example, in many novels, the characters struggle with being Taiwanese while also having to adapt to the rules and cultures imposed by colonizers like the Dutch, Spanish, or Japanese.
